Numerical methods involve using mathematical algorithms and computational tools to approximate solutions to problems that may be too difficult to solve analytically. In Mumbai, these methods are widely employed in diverse fields such as engineering, finance, data analysis, and computer science. One of the key areas where numerical methods are heavily used in Mumbai is in engineering, especially in the design and analysis of structures and systems. Engineers in Mumbai use numerical techniques to simulate the behavior of bridges, buildings, and mechanical components to ensure their safety and efficiency. Finite element analysis, computational fluid dynamics, and optimization algorithms are some of the numerical methods commonly applied in engineering practices in Mumbai. In the financial sector, numerical methods play a crucial role in analyzing market trends, forecasting price movements, and managing risk. Mumbai, being a financial hub in India, sees a significant application of numerical methods in algorithmic trading, risk assessment, and portfolio optimization. Monte Carlo simulation, Black-Scholes model, and numerical integration techniques are popular tools used by financial analysts and traders in Mumbai. Moreover, Mumbai's rapidly growing tech industry relies on numerical methods for data analysis, machine learning, and artificial intelligence applications. Data scientists and software developers in Mumbai leverage numerical algorithms to process large datasets, build predictive models, and optimize algorithms for efficiency. Numerical techniques such as regression analysis, clustering algorithms, and neural networks are extensively used to derive insights and drive innovation in the tech ecosystem of Mumbai.
